I cant believe it's been four weeks! I have an appointment with the plastic surgeon today for before and after photos. My ears and area around my ears still feel numb; lower glands area below the back of my ears are still swollen. occasionally this area feels very tender and tight so I take arnica pills and Alene. Sometimes a cold gel pack applied to the area for 15 minutes works just as well.
Regarding the lip lift, the sutures underneath my nose have not completely dissolved. Some feel like splinters when I tough them, also there are tiny bumps where they protrude. I've been told to use a wash rag to help them dissolve faster, but don't think this has really helped. I'll ask the ps about it today, and see if they can do anything to remove them.
My scars on my upper eyelid looks like eyeshadow on the crease of my eyes. They actually enhance my eyes, just like make up. I'm guessing they will fade over time.
With the lower eyelid surgery where fat on lower eyelids were removed, I feel it changed how my eyes look- maybe more slanted? Not complaining, although I use liquid eyeliner to make my eyes appear larger and more 'round'.
Feeling I'd tightness and pressure on my neck area gets better every day. so far, I'm very pleased with the results and rate of recovery. Good luck to all my sisters who are currently healing, or about to have their surgery done I. The next few months!

I do feel my right side is more swollen. Also, the right side of my head from the lower face lift is more sore and swollen, not sure why. DOc did say that each side is independent from the other in how they react to the surgery and heal; he said its normal to have some differences such as degree of swelling.
I'm glad to know there's still swelling, versus permanent change I the shape of my eyes. The ps said that eyelid surgery wouldn't change the shape of the eyes, however the upper eyelid tightening may lower the eyebrow slightly. I didn't notice this with mine, tho.
